Novelis Oswego is located in northern Central New York on the shores of Lake Ontario and employs approximately 1200 people. The Oswego plant produces more than one billion pounds of high-quality aluminum sheet each year serving customers in the automotive beverage can and specialty markets. ITT is seeking individuals to operate in a fast-paced, high-energy, start-up environment to launch new sustainable products to market with accelerated commercial success. Flow machines (pumps, fans, compressors) are one of the largest consumers of energy on the planet and account for approximately 35% of global electricity consumption. VIDAR has developed new variable speed motors that reduce energy of flow machines as much as 50%.
